Key Nutritional Advantages
| Nutrient / Metric | Cured Tuna (100g) | Black Mussels (100g) |
|---|---|---|
| Calories | 132 kcal | 172 kcal |
| Protein | 28g | 24g |
| Fats | 1g | 4g |
| Carbohydrates | 0g | 7g |
| Dietary Fiber | 0g | 0g |
| GIGlycemic Index | 0 | 0 |
| Water Content | 70% | 80% |

2. Micronutrient Profile (Vitamins and Minerals)
Micronutrient analysis highlights the essential vitamins and minerals of each food, expressed as a percentage of the recommended Daily Value (%DV).
Cured Tuna's profile is highly notable for: vitamin-b12 (9µg, 375% VDR) and vitamin b3 (niacin) (18mg, 113% VDR) and selenium (40µg, 73% VDR).
Conversely, Black Mussels stands out especially in: vitamin-b12 (20µg, 333% VDR) and iron (6.7mg, 37% VDR) and zinc (1.8mg, 16% VDR).
